Health Clubs to be set up in Bandipora

Bandipora: To finalize the arrangements for setting up Health Clubs at Pachayat Level in the Bandipora district, an officers` meeting was held here under the chair of ADC, Mr Zahoor Ahmad Mir. The establishing health clubs are aimed to help Government in containing the spread of COVID-19) in rural areas by timely screening and identification of suspects, pre-symptomatic/asymptomatic.

It was given out that Rs 2 lakh have been sanctioned for each Panchayat for setting up of health clubs while accommodation, food, medical equipments will be provided by Panchayat Raj Institutions. The Health Clubs will oversee availability of masks, pulse oximeter, sodium hypochlorite solution and vital drugs besides addressing myths, misinformation and fake news on social media by verifying the facts from the Government agencies.

The district administration will ensure imparting of necessary training to the teams of the Health Clubs through Health and Medical Education and Rural Development Departments so that they take care of the Covid persons under Quarantine/ Isolation. The teams will be trained to launch surveillance activities in coordination with Health Department authorities, ensure screening and surveillance of travelers arriving in the village and monitor their home quarantine/ isolation. The concerned officers were directed to make the clubs functional early.

The meeting was attended by Block Development Chairmen, Chief Medical Officer Bashir Ahmad, District Panchayat Officer Nazir Ahmad, Sarpanchs, BDOs and officers of the Health Department. Meeting discussed threadbare various issues regarding the constitution of Health Clubs including training, availability of logistics including masks, sanitizers and other medical instruments.
